Transaction f151e33f32a03d160c29ba913185d2529c9203979aefe69534afed6fa16d60e3
1 Input
1 Output
-
f151e33f32a03d160c29ba913185d2529c9203979aefe69534afed6fa16d60e3:0
- value
- 755791
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c3e603469727953508bb1f779343f3dc8d8febb
- address
- bc1qlslxqdrfwfu4x5ytk8mhjdpl8hyd3l4mdr2jma